{"id":2967,"date":"2017-11-17T13:51:19","date_gmt":"2017-11-17T13:51:19","guid":{"rendered":"http:\/\/support.loginextsolutions.com\/?p=2967"},"modified":"2026-04-10T12:43:35","modified_gmt":"2026-04-10T12:43:35","slug":"integration-best-practices","status":"publish","type":"post","link":"https:\/\/support.loginextsolutions.com\/index.php\/2017\/11\/17\/integration-best-practices\/","title":{"rendered":"Integration Best Practices"},"content":{"rendered":"\n\n\n\n\n\n\n<div class=\"segment segment-reversed\">\n<div class=\"container\">\n<div class=\"segment-content\">\n<div class=\"segment-inner-content main\">\n<div class=\"loginext-articles\">\n<div><\/div>\n<article>Using the LogiNext API, clients can integrate all segments of their logistics and supply chain network into our platform\u2014enabling a seamless experience for their operations and executive teams.<p><\/p>\n<h4 data-start=\"410\" data-end=\"426\">API Endpoint<\/h4>\n<p data-start=\"428\" data-end=\"523\">The base URL for all requests to the LogiNext API is:<br data-start=\"481\" data-end=\"484\"><strong data-start=\"484\" data-end=\"523\"><code data-start=\"486\" data-end=\"521\">https:\/\/api.loginextsolutions.com<\/code><\/strong><\/p>\n<p data-start=\"525\" data-end=\"560\">Our API is REST-based, meaning:<\/p>\n<ul data-start=\"562\" data-end=\"877\">\n<li data-start=\"562\" data-end=\"638\">\n<p data-start=\"564\" data-end=\"638\">Standard HTTP verbs are used: GET, PUT, POST, and DELETE<\/p>\n<\/li>\n<li data-start=\"639\" data-end=\"716\">\n<p data-start=\"641\" data-end=\"716\">Responses follow standard HTTP status codes to indicate success or errors<\/p>\n<\/li>\n<li data-start=\"717\" data-end=\"815\">\n<p data-start=\"719\" data-end=\"815\">Input dates (e.g., <code data-start=\"738\" data-end=\"764\">2016-07-01T11:18:00.000Z<\/code>) must be in Coordinated Universal Time (UTC)<\/p>\n<\/li>\n<li data-start=\"816\" data-end=\"877\">\n<p data-start=\"818\" data-end=\"877\">Authentication is handled via HTTP Basic Authentication<\/p>\n<\/li>\n<\/ul>\n<h4>Language Support<\/h4>\n<p>LogiNext supports multilingual deployments. We use external language files to manage in-app text, making it easy to modify and add translations as needed.<\/p>\n<p data-start=\"1132\" data-end=\"1173\">Our configuration model supports setting:<\/p>\n<ul data-start=\"1174\" data-end=\"1270\">\n<li data-start=\"1174\" data-end=\"1213\">\n<p data-start=\"1176\" data-end=\"1213\">A default language for dashboards<\/p>\n<\/li>\n<li data-start=\"1214\" data-end=\"1270\">\n<p data-start=\"1216\" data-end=\"1270\">Region-specific languages\/dialects for mobile apps<\/p>\n<\/li>\n<\/ul>\n<h4>Deprecation Policy<\/h4>\n<p>The current production version is v2. When a new version of APIs is made generally available (not beta), the older version will be deprecated and will cease to function after six months. Deprecated APIs will return a 404 error once removed.<\/p>\n<h4>Breaking Change Policy<\/h4>\n<p>Changes that do not break an API, such as adding a new attribute can be made at any time. Changes that break a production API, such as removing attributes or making major changes to the API\u2019s behavior will only be done with advance notice of 60 days. Exceptions may occur in rare cases involving security, performance, or legal concerns.<\/p>\n<h4>Recommendations for Clients<\/h4>\n<ul>\n<li><strong data-start=\"323\" data-end=\"362\">Queue API calls on the client side:<\/strong> This enables buffering and retry mechanisms in case the rate limit is exceeded. When the limit is hit, clients should respect the <code data-start=\"493\" data-end=\"506\">Retry-After<\/code> duration before attempting again. To learn about our API rate limits, visit <strong data-start=\"1681\" data-end=\"1760\"><a class=\"\" href=\"https:\/\/products.loginextsolutions.com\/product\/#\/developersPortal\" target=\"_new\" rel=\"noopener\" data-start=\"1683\" data-end=\"1758\">the Developer Portal<\/a>.<\/strong><\/li>\n<li><strong data-start=\"544\" data-end=\"605\">Avoid making API calls directly from mobile applications:<\/strong> It is recommended that requests be routed through the client\u2019s own servers, which can then make the API calls to LogiNext. This provides flexibility in handling endpoint changes without requiring end-user app updates.<\/li>\n<li><strong data-start=\"827\" data-end=\"878\">Leverage HTTP connection reuse or multiplexing:<\/strong> Clients should reuse HTTP connections where possible to avoid the overhead of repeatedly opening TCP connections, thereby improving efficiency.<\/li>\n<\/ul>\n<\/article>\n<\/div>\n<\/div>\n<\/div>\n<\/div>\n<\/div>\n\n\n\n<p><!-- Created with Elementor --><!-- Created with Elementor --><!-- Created with Elementor --><!-- Created with Elementor --><!-- Created with Elementor --><!-- Created with Elementor --><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Using the LogiNext API, clients can integrate all segments of their logistics and supply chain network into our platform\u2014enabling a seamless experience for their operations and executive teams. API Endpoint The base URL for all requests to the LogiNext API &hellip; <a href=\"https:\/\/support.loginextsolutions.com\/index.php\/2017\/11\/17\/integration-best-practices\/\">Continued<\/a><\/p>\n","protected":false},"author":8,"featured_media":0,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_bbp_topic_count":0,"_bbp_reply_count":0,"_bbp_total_topic_count":0,"_bbp_total_reply_count":0,"_bbp_voice_count":0,"_bbp_anonymous_reply_count":0,"_bbp_topic_count_hidden":0,"_bbp_reply_count_hidden":0,"_bbp_forum_subforum_count":0,"footnotes":""},"categories":[],"tags":[3011,3013,3014,3016,3017,3018,3019,3020],"_links":{"self":[{"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/posts\/2967"}],"collection":[{"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/users\/8"}],"replies":[{"embeddable":true,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/comments?post=2967"}],"version-history":[{"count":24,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/posts\/2967\/revisions"}],"predecessor-version":[{"id":32612,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/posts\/2967\/revisions\/32612"}],"wp:attachment":[{"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/media?parent=2967"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/categories?post=2967"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/support.loginextsolutions.com\/index.php\/wp-json\/wp\/v2\/tags?post=2967"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}